Photos of 9 day old baby who survived after alleged Fulani herdsmen killed her mother in Benue and left her father fighting for life
















Benue state born reporter, Raphael Akume posted photos of a baby girl who was dropped on her mother's lifeless body by alleged Fulani herdsmen during a recent attack in Agatu.

The child's father survived the attack but is still receiving treatment in the hospital. Read his post below.

"This is the baby that the Herdsmen that attacked Agatu recently after killing the mum dropped her on her mother lifeless body. In the quest to get the story complete I traced and founded her somewhere in makurdi. The father who survived the attack is still in the hospital.
Wife of the Benue state Governor Samuel Ortom, Her Excellency Eunice Ortom a mother per excellence was the first to reach out to her, she called the nine days old baby "MIRACLE BABY"
And so she is known till date....."

Claudio Ranieri sacked by Premiership club Fulham
Italian football manager, Claudio Ranieri has been sacked as manager of Premiership club Fulham, with first-team coach and former footballer Scott Parker taking temporary charge.

His dismissal comes after he lost  2-0 to Southampton on Wednesday, which left the club19th in the Premier League, 10 points from safety with 10 games left.

Ranieri who led Leicester to an unlikely title triumph back in 2016, said in a statement: 'I am obviously disappointed with the recent results and that we could not build on the good start we made following my appointment. 
'Finally, I would like to thank the club, the players and the fans for the support they have given me during my time at the club.'

Chairman of the club,  Shahid Khan said in a statement: Following our discussion this afternoon, Claudio Ranieri agreed with my decision that a change was in the best interest of everyone,' chairman Shahid Khan said in a statement. 
'No surprise to me, Claudio was a perfect gentleman, as always. 
'Claudio’s tenure at Fulham didn’t produce the outcome we anticipated and needed when I appointed him as manager in November, but be assured he is not solely to blame for the position we are in today.
'Claudio walked into a difficult situation, inheriting a side that gained only one point in its prior eight matches, and he provided an immediate boost by leading our club to nine points in his first eight matches as manager. 
'Though we were unable to maintain that pace thereafter, I am grateful for his effort. Claudio leaves Fulham as our friend and he will undoubtedly experience success again soon.' 
Ranieri was due to take a recovery session on Thursday, but Scott Parker now takes over on an interim basis.
'Scott’s immediate assignment is merely to help us stabilise, grow and rediscover ourselves as a football club,' Shahid Khan continued. 'If Scott can answer that challenge, and our players respond to the opportunity, perhaps victories will follow in the months ahead.'

Canadian comedian Boyd Banks lands in trouble for licking and kissing a CBC Reporter on Live TV (Video)
Canadian comedian, Boyd Banks has been accused of sexually harassing a CBC reporter on Live TV.

The incident occurred on Tuesday night at Comedy Bar, a comedy club in west Toronto, where CBC reporter Chris Glover was reporting from during the event Just For Laughs. A “town hall” which was held by the Canadian Association of Stand-Up Comedians.

While reporting live, two comedians stood behind Glover popping their heads over his shoulders, before Comedian Boyd Banks then began licking his ear and kissing him in the neck.
Banks has since apologized for his behavior and admitting that he is guilty of everything he’s been accused of.
“I am an idiot, and there’s something wrong with me. I’m not making excuses. I want to apologize to the stand-up community in Canada and, of course, the reporter who was doing his job.”
The Canadian Association of Stand-up Comedians, which held the event Glover was covering, also issued a statement apologizing to Glover and calling Banks’s actions “despicable.”
But according to Pedestrian.tv, the CBC reporter has filed a police complaint against the comedian for violating one of the most obvious rules of human interaction: 'don’t put your tongue on strangers when they’re just trying to do their jobs.'

Trouble in paradise as Kylie Jenner accuses Travis Scott of cheating












Travis Scott and Kylie Jenner's relationship is being tested at the moment after the make-up mogul accused the rapper of infidelity.

Travis postponed his AstroWorld concert in Buffalo Thursday night and claimed he did so because of illness. But TMZ has revealed it's because Kylie accused him of cheating so he has to stay in Los Angeles to sort out his relationship first.

The rapper reportedly flew back home to surprise Kylie and his daughter Stormi and as they were at Kylie's home, she claimed to discover evidence he cheated on her. This led to an argument on Wednesday night and it continued into Thursday.

Travis' reps say the rapper denies he cheated on Kylie.

President Buhari’s re-election is a triumph of ordinary Nigerians over elite – FG









The Federal Government has described President Buhari’s electoral victory as the triumph of ordinary Nigerians over the nation’s elite.

Minister of Information and Culture, Lai Mohammed, said this when he received the management of his ministry in his office yesterday February 28th. The ministry workers were in his office to congratulate him on the victory of the APC in last Saturday’s Presidential and National Assembly elections.


“Last weekend’s election is a direct contest between ordinary Nigerians and the elite, most of whom are rent seekers. Of course, the ordinary Nigerians have won!” he said.

Mohammed said the President's victory is a confirmation of the fact that ordinary Nigerians appreciate the pro-people policies of the present administration which, he said, is doing more with far less resources.


“Overall, this government is doing more with less and is restoring decency and integrity to governance. Like the New York Times said, the re-election of President Buhari is a referendum on honesty. There is no better way to put it,” he stated.

While reeling out the policies that endeared President Buhari to the ordinary Nigerians, the Minister said under the Social Investment Programme, the government feeds 9.3 million school children everyday and some 500,000 unemployed graduates have been employed under N-Power, in addition to some 300,000 families who are benefitting from the Conditional Cash Transfer.

He said in a deliberate effort to boost the Small and Medium Enterprises to contribute significantly to the nation’s economy, the Buhari Administration gives out interest-free loans of between N10,000 and N100,000 under the TraderMoni and the MarketMoni Schemes to small business owners.


“Pensioners who have been left in the lurch are being paid, and I am talking of ex-workers of the Nigerian Airways, NITEL and former Biafran Policemen, among others. The former Nigeria Airways staffers were so delighted that they held a rally in support of the President
before the elections,” Alhaji Mohammed said.

He said the fight against corruption is being institutionalized with a number of policies that include Treasury Single Account (TSA), Whistleblower policy, and that it has led to the recovery of huge amounts of money as well as property from looters.

The Minister therefore enjoined the citizenry to continue to support the Buhari Administration in building of a strong, secure, economically-buoyant and corrupt-free society.
